Forum: Mikrocontroller und Digitale Elektronik µC 1806 Datenblatt und Assembler?


von Hans G. (weakbit)


Lesenswert?

Hallo,
ich bin auf der suche nach dem uralt µC 1806 und einem 
Entwicklungswerkzeug wie einen Assembler/C-compiler. Weiß Jemand wo man 
so ein altes Teil noch finden kann? und den dazugehörigen Assembler 
und/oder compiler?

Danke

von H. H. (Gast)


Lesenswert?


von Christoph db1uq K. (christoph_kessler)


Lesenswert?

> uralt
Ich nehme an es geht um AM1806
https://www.ti.com/product/AM1806
ein ARM Prozessor, Datenblatt von 2010/2014:
https://www.ti.com/lit/ds/symlink/am1806.pdf
Status "active"
https://www.mouser.de/c/semiconductors/embedded-processors-controllers/microprocessors-mpu/?m=Texas%20Instruments&series=AM1806
da gibt es noch Bestände und Entwicklungswerkzeuge

von Christoph db1uq K. (christoph_kessler)


Lesenswert?


: Bearbeitet durch User
von Bauform B. (bauformb)


Lesenswert?

Hans G. schrieb:
> …den dazugehörigen Assembler und/oder compiler?

Vom Assembler gab’s erst letzte Woche ein Update

> http://john.ccac.rwth-aachen.de:8000/as/

Die Compilerbauer jammern ja immer über Registermangel, hier gibt es 16 
16-Bit Universal-Register, also kein Problem ;)

Überhaupt ist das eine oberaffengeile RISC-Maschine, viel Spaß damit! 
Willst du eine eigene Platine bauen?

von Hans G. (weakbit)


Lesenswert?

Vielen Dank für die vielen Antworten.
Aber der ist uralt hier steht: "1806 production started Q3 1981"

Ich möchte ein Programm das mehr als 25Jahre alt ist abändern. Es 
handelt sich dabei um eine C-Netz Telefon MT4001 das man als Amateurfunk 
Gerät verwenden kann (nach Hardware Umbau). Dabei habe ich folgendes 
Problem: die Repeaterablage ist eingeschränkt und kann in unserem Fall 
nicht unter R70 438.650MHz RX -7,6MHz shift 431,050MHz eingegeben 
werden. Wir haben hier aber Repeater die darunter liegen und die sind 
dann nicht erreichbar.
Nun meine Aufgabe ich soll herausfinden wo die Limits eingestellt sind 
einen Source habe ich aber ob der funktioniert kann ich nicht sagen.

@bauformb - nein ich will keine eigene Maschine bauen. Warum sollte man 
so etwas machen hast du eine Idee für was man den brauchen kann?

Danke
weakbit

: Bearbeitet durch User
von Christoph db1uq K. (christoph_kessler)


Lesenswert?

Ich hatte schon gelegentlich von solchen Umbauten gelesen, das scheint 
aber eher für Siemens oder Motorola zu existieren, oder noch ältere 
Bosch KFT-Typen.
Ja dann viel Erfolg beim reverse-engineering.

http://www.oebl.de/C-Netz/Geraete/Bosch/OF51/OF51ebg.html
http://www.oebl.de/C-Netz/Geraete/Bosch/OF6/Bosch_OF6.html
leider keine Serviceunterlagen

: Bearbeitet durch User
von Christoph db1uq K. (christoph_kessler)


Lesenswert?

So ähnlich habe ich vor Jahren meinen analogen Satreceiver 
disassembliert. Der hatte einen Mitsubishi M50740, kompatibel zu 65C02 
(wie auch Wikipedia bestätigt):
https://en.wikipedia.org/wiki/Mitsubishi_740
Dazu habe ich ein Datenbuch von 1986

Mein Disassembler konnte aber nur den Standard-Befehlssatz des 6502, 
sodaß ich die paar zusätzlichen Befehle zu Fuß decodieren musste. Die 
Ansteuerung der PLL habe ich soweit herausgefunden, dass ich die 
Startfrequenz beim Einschalten auf die ATV-Ausgabe von DB0OFG stellen 
konnte. Lang her.

Den oben verlinkten Assembler von Alfred Arnold habe ich auch 
gelegentlich benutzt.

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.